<dcvalue element="description" qualifier="abstract">Wireless&#x20;activation&#x20;of&#x20;the&#x20;enteric&#x20;nervous&#x20;system&#x20;(ENS)&#x20;in&#x20;freely&#x20;moving&#x20;animals&#x20;with&#x20;implantable&#x20;optogenetic&#x20;devices&#x20;offers&#x20;a&#x20;unique&#x20;and&#x20;exciting&#x20;opportunity&#x20;to&#x20;selectively&#x20;control&#x20;gastrointestinal&#x20;(GI)&#x20;transit&#x20;in&#x20;vivo,&#x20;including&#x20;the&#x20;gut-brain&#x20;axis.&#x20;Programmed&#x20;delivery&#x20;of&#x20;light&#x20;to&#x20;targeted&#x20;locations&#x20;in&#x20;the&#x20;GI-tract,&#x20;however,&#x20;poses&#x20;many&#x20;challenges&#x20;not&#x20;encountered&#x20;within&#x20;the&#x20;central&#x20;nervous&#x20;system&#x20;(CNS).&#x20;We&#x20;report&#x20;here&#x20;the&#x20;development&#x20;of&#x20;a&#x20;fully&#x20;implantable,&#x20;battery-free&#x20;wireless&#x20;device&#x20;specifically&#x20;designed&#x20;for&#x20;optogenetic&#x20;control&#x20;of&#x20;the&#x20;GI-tract,&#x20;capable&#x20;of&#x20;generating&#x20;sufficient&#x20;light&#x20;over&#x20;large&#x20;areas&#x20;to&#x20;robustly&#x20;activate&#x20;the&#x20;ENS,&#x20;potently&#x20;inducing&#x20;colonic&#x20;motility&#x20;ex&#x20;vivo&#x20;and&#x20;increased&#x20;propulsion&#x20;in&#x20;vivo.&#x20;Use&#x20;in&#x20;in&#x20;vivo&#x20;studies&#x20;reveals&#x20;unique&#x20;stimulation&#x20;patterns&#x20;that&#x20;increase&#x20;expulsion&#x20;of&#x20;colonic&#x20;content,&#x20;likely&#x20;mediated&#x20;in&#x20;part&#x20;by&#x20;activation&#x20;of&#x20;an&#x20;extrinsic&#x20;brain-gut&#x20;motor&#x20;pathway,&#x20;via&#x20;pelvic&#x20;nerves.&#x20;This&#x20;technology&#x20;overcomes&#x20;major&#x20;limitations&#x20;of&#x20;conventional&#x20;wireless&#x20;optogenetic&#x20;hardware&#x20;designed&#x20;for&#x20;the&#x20;CNS,&#x20;providing&#x20;targeted&#x20;control&#x20;of&#x20;specific&#x20;neurochemical&#x20;classes&#x20;of&#x20;neurons&#x20;in&#x20;the&#x20;ENS&#x20;and&#x20;brain-gut&#x20;axis,&#x20;for&#x20;direct&#x20;modulation&#x20;of&#x20;GI-transit&#x20;and&#x20;associated&#x20;behaviours&#x20;in&#x20;freely&#x20;moving&#x20;animals.</dcvalue>
